Poland - Hospital Discharges for Fracture of Femur

Since 2014, Poland Hospital Discharges for Fracture of Femur rose 3.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 11 comparing other countries in Hospital Discharges for Fracture of Femur at 42,678 Hospital Discharges. Poland is overtaken by Australia, which was number 10 at 47,407 Hospital Discharges and is followed by Canada at 40,224 Hospital Discharges. Germany, Italy and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Australia witnessed the best average annual growth at +9.6% per year, while Sweden was the worst growing country at -1% per year.
